List of incompatible devices
Those devices were tested with DD-WRT, but tests failed.
- Linksys WRT54Gv7
- Linksys WRT300Nv2
- Siemens SE505v3

Comparison Table
Brand | Model | Hardware revision | Serial number | Additional notes |
Linksys | WRT54G | v7 | Begins with CDFE | Uses Atheros chip and runs VxWorks |
WRT300N | v2 | ? | N/A | |
Siemens | SE505 | v3 | ends with R107-4 | N/A |
